Greddy turbo kit question
I have a question. Has anyone used a JG/Edelbrock I/M with the 18g?
I heard the 18g does not push enough air to see any gains from it and that you might lose some power with it. Is this true? Kinda going for 350whp and already own the manifold

Re: Greddy turbo kit question (APEX i GSR)
I would say that anyone who thinks just because a turbo is small you are going to lose hp by adding something that causes less restriction is a dumbass.
Might as well not upgrade the downpipe or not switch to an external gate.
In all seriousness, i think that you will have nothing but a gain when adding a intake manifold with larger pleniums no matter what your turbo size is, and yeah you might lose a little power down low, but its worth the top end IMO.
And if all motor applications gain power off of it, why wouldnt a boosted car gain even more.

Re: Greddy turbo kit question (APEX i GSR)
I have an 18G as well and I decided against the Victor X. My car is daily driven and seldom raced, so throttle response is more important to me than more power in the upper powerband with a soggy low end.
